"Self Mastery Through Understanding ; A Treatise on Leavitt-Science" is a detailed exploration of personal empowerment and mental discipline written by Dr. C. Franklin Leavitt. This work presents a systematic approach to overcoming psychological barriers, emphasizing the power of the human mind to influence physical health and emotional stability. Through the principles of what the author terms Leavitt-Science, the book offers a method for individuals to achieve greater self-control, confidence, and internal harmony.
Drawing upon the evolving psychological theories of the early twentieth century, the text examines the intricate relationship between the conscious and subconscious mind. It provides practical insights into managing stress, anxiety, and various nervous conditions by utilizing understanding and cognitive redirection. The treatise guides readers through philosophies aimed at fostering a positive mental attitude and unlocking latent human potential.
As a significant contribution to the New Thought movement and self-improvement literature, this work offers a fascinating look into the historical foundations of modern self-help techniques. "Self Mastery Through Understanding" serves as a timeless manual for those seeking to master their internal world and lead a more focused, purposeful life.
